Ofunaofu:
Last Thursday morning at Gbagidi, Ijanikin
area of Lagos State, a housewife known as Iya
Deborah, reportedly emptied a bowl of hot water on
her husband, identified as Ajagadi.
Iya Deborah had complained bitterly after her
husband gave her N700, out of the N800 he had, to
prepare yam and sauce breakfast for the family.
She bought the yam, but emptied the boiling water
on her husband, who was fiddling with his phone in
the sitting room, waiting for his meal.
The couple have been married for eight years, has
four children, including a six-month-old baby.
A neighbour said: “I was in front of the compound
when I heard the victim screaming and his wife
running out of the compound as if the devil was
chasing her. Neighbours who were still in the
compound ran into their apartment only to see him
in pains.
“When we asked him what happened, he said his
wife poured hot water on him. We bought raw eggs
and honey which we poured on the burns, before
taking him to the hospital.”
Vanguard learned that angry neighbours later caught
Iya Deborah, and dragged her to the hospital.
When Vanguard visited the victim at Ademola
Hospital, he was still writhing in pains from burns
and blisters on his chest, face, right hand, and lap.
‘It’s the devil’
A nurse told Vanguard, on the condition of
anonymity: “When the wife of the victim came to
the hospital, she kept saying that she did it because
the money her husband gave to her was too little.
She alleged that he has been cheating on her with
other women and keeps complaining that there was
no money, but keeps spending on his lovers.
Feeling a lot more remorseful, Iya Deborah, who is
currently undergoing interrogation at Ijanikin Police
Divisional Headquarters, said: “I don’t know what
came over me; it is the devil’s handiwork.”
Vanguard gathered that the suspect once attacked a
neigh-bour in their former compound with hot
groundnut oil.
